c 字串編碼編碼 encoding 使用方法示例

2022-09-26 09:06:11 字數 606 閱讀 5479

unicode有四種編碼格式,utf-8, utf-16,utf-32,utf-7。

字元編碼類,asciiencoding ,utf7encoding,unicodeencoding,utf32encoding。

複製** **如下:

using system.collectio

using system.text;

namespace asciiencodingdemo

]", c);

程式設計客棧     }

console.writeline("");

console.writeline("解碼後的字串:");

//下面的語句將對encodebytes位元組陣列的內容進行解碼

string decodestr = myascii.getstring(encodebytes);

&nb程式設計客棧sp;        console.writeline(decodestr);

conswww.cppcns.comole.readline();         }}

}

本文標題: c#字串編碼編碼(encoding)使用方法示例

本文位址:

字串編碼

1.unicode 的編碼方式 編碼類似1小時和60分鐘的關係,本質的時間刻度還是相同的。unicode 編碼有 utf 8 utf 16 和 utf 32 它們都是將數字轉換到程式資料的編碼方案。utf 8 以位元組為單位。表示乙個字元時,能用乙個位元組就不用兩個或者三個位元組表示。utf 16 ...

c 字串的編碼?

c 字串載入到記憶體裡面是什麼編碼格式的?win7中文系統下,控制台預設是gbk編碼的,用gbk格式儲存的原始檔,中文字串在vs2010下編譯輸出到控制台會正常輸出 但是vs2010裡面採用utf 8無bom的原始檔 輸出中文字串到終端就出現亂碼了 所以 是不是c 把字串的值載入到記憶體中時 是按照...

字串與編碼

首先應該把位元組陣列看成是string的載體。dot net使用的字串string是unicode編碼的 它也是以unicode編碼的形式顯示字串。以下是用自己語言對幾個常用函式的說明 自己總結的,反正看不明msdn bytes system.text.encoding.unicode.getbyt...